When it comes to a piece like the Mozart Clarinet Concerto, a few words or phrases regularly come up: the concerto is described as "mellow" or Mozart's "swan song," but most often it is described as "perfect." Such a perfect piece as Mozart's Clarinet Concerto must have been hugely popular during Mozart's lifetime, right? It must have been played all over, by all the virtuoso clarinetists of the day. Well, that is not even close to the case. At the age of 35, Mozart was kind of old news in the economically depressed, repressed, and censored city of Vienna in 1790. There were very few concerts during this period, and Mozart's popularity had waned severely. The clarinet concerto, one of a wealth of brilliant (and yes, perfect) pieces Mozart wrote in the final year of his life, was performed once by the man for whom Mozart wrote it, Anton Stadler, before Mozart's death, but the location and the program of that concert are forgotten. The manuscript of the concerto is lost, which means we actually don't know a lot about it, especially considering it wasn't actually written for a standard clarinet, but for a basset clarinet (we'll get to that later). The piece was written just about two months before Mozart's death and was his last completed work, though there's absolutely no evidence that Mozart knew he was dying when he wrote it. All in all, there's actually a lot of mystery surrounding this perfect piece, and yet, when we hear the luminous music that Mozart wrote, all of this falls away. There is truly a kind of perfection to this music, a golden quality that is inescapable. There is no clarinet concerto that is performed more often or more recorded, and it remains a perennial favorite for clarinetists and orchestras around the world.
